Contemporary Research QMOD-SDI 2 Encoder with Dual SDI and Composite The dual-channel QMOD-SDI2, with two SDI inputs, sets a new standard for sports, motion and digital signage encoding. Dual hardware scalers accept content up to 3G 1080p, shapes digital signage for edge-to-edge presentation, and compensates for non-broadcast and PAL refresh rates. Able to deliver two HD programs in one channel, the QMOD-SDI 2 can also output the content as a Multicast or Unicast IPTV stream. Options include dual-language SAP audio, easy front-panel setup and alternate audio and NTSC video inputs. Web setup, monitoring, and firmware updates are available via USB and Ethernet ports. Two-across mounting offers up to four programs per rack space, with the ability to mix models to handle HDMI, SDI, Component, RGBHV and NTSC video sources. Version 2.3.4 Update reduces end-to-end RF latency to 500 ms and adds RTP protocol for IP streaming. Key Features Two HD-SDI inputs, 3G 1080p and 1080i/720p 59.94/60 Hz HD-SDI, and SD-SDI 480i widescreen/4:3 video; also accepts embedded 608/708 captioning and AES audio Two Composite/CC video inputs for encoding, captioning, or EAS use Two analog Stereo and two SPDIF coax audio inputs Creates a high-definition dual-program 720p/1080i MPEG-2 stream for broadcast over RF or IPTV Converts stereo and PCM to stereo AC-3, can create SAP dual-language audio for each program Embedded Line 21 captioning from composite video inputs Dual hardware scalers accept up to1080p 3G video, including 60/30 Hz, and PAL formats, and can deliver programs at a set resolution Dual-channel operation is standard, creates one physical channel with two HD programs Delivers a fully agile QAM 64/256 digital cable channel 2-135 Up to 268 HD Programs, 134 Channels per system Streams Multicast or Unicast IPTV from GigE Ethernet port Distributes channel over an on-site broadband cable system with adjustable output level up to 29 dBmV, compatible with all CATV format broadband systems Set up with front-panel buttons and easy to use menus; including inputs, encoding, channel, and RF options or use onboard Web page for setup and monitoring Update firmware from USB or Ethernet Fan cooled, with variable speeds Includes compact switching power supply Saves power and rack space using efficient 1/2 rack width design Mounts in optional 1RU single (RK1) or dual (RK2EZ) 19” rack mount kits Meets RoHS safety and California energy standards Technical Specifications Physical 8.5” <216mm> wide x 1.73” <62mm> height (1RU) x 6.0” <153mm> deep 1.5 lbs <0.68kg> +32 Degrees to 122 Degrees F operating temperature, convection cooled Rack mounting for one- or two-units side-by-side optional (RK1, RK2EZ) For HRF Half-Racks, use the RK2EZ kit to mount each modulator Fan cooled, with variable speeds Scaling Dual hardware scalers Accepts 480i - 1080p video and various computer graphics resolutions Edge to edge presentation with zoom, shrink and X/Y axis positioning Native or scales to fixed output resolution, 1080p scaled to 1080i Encoding MPEG2/H.264 Profile MP@HL for HD, MP@ML for SD 1080i, 720p, 576i, 480p, and 480i output resolution MPEG2 Video Encoding bitrate 10-25 Mbps, HD, 5-6 Mbps 480i, variable bitrate if set for IP output only H.264 Video Encoding bitrate 5-10 Mbps, HD, 2-4 Mbps 480i, or variable bitrate if set for IP output only Converts PCM or MPEG1, Layer 2 audio to stereo AC-3, AAC or MP12, pass-through AC-3 SAP Dual-language capability, second audio track is MPEG1, Layer 2 Dual encoders can stream a simultaneous MPEG2 or H.264 QAM MPTS stream and separate IP SPTS streams, or one encoder can process an MPEG2 stream for QAM, and the second can process an H.264 IP stream Modulation Switchable 64/256 QAM, J83 Annex B, Interleaving Modes (128,1) MER 38 dB typical Compliance FCC Class B, RoHS, meets California energy standards Front Panel Menu Setup with front panel Select and Directional buttons Menu LCD, Blue with 2 lines of 20 white characters each Back Panel Power 2.1mm coaxial jack (inside center conductor positive) 1.1A maximum, 11.5 to 13.5 VDC, 12 VDC typical EAS 3 GPI Pins for latching control, SW(NO) for closure, V+ 5-12 VDC, Ground Ethernet RJ-45 GigE Ethernet connector for IP control, updates, Unicast or Multicast IPTV, and internal Web page SDI Two BNC Female inputs SD-SDI @ 270Mb/s, HD-SDI @ 1.485Gb/s, 3G SDI Level A @ 2.970Gb/s Coax cable auto-equalizer for SD up to 460m, HD up to 230m (RG6) 3G Resolutions 1080p at 50/59.94/60Hz, HD 1080i at 25/29.97/30Hz, 720p at 59.94/60Hz, or SD 480i at 29.97Hz Video Format YCbCr 4:2:2 Accepts SDI embedded Stereo/AC-3 48/44.1KHz audio Widescreen option for 480i Composite Video/CC RCA female (480i), 29.97 Hz, supplies Line 21 captioning Digital Audio Two coax SPDIF inputs Analog Audio Two stereo 3.5mm inputs Inputs assignable to video inputs RF ‘F’, female, 75-ohm impedance Agile, channels 2-135 (57-861 MHz), standard, HRC, or IRC spacing 6 MHz bandwidth fits any open channel without interference to adjacent channels 1 KHz resolution, +/- 30 ppm accuracy, +/- 35 ppm stability 29 dBmv typical output power, attenuated in 5 steps, approx. 4 dB Item Includes PS12-2 Switching power supply, 2A 12VDC, standard AC cord for power strips Option to include PS12-8-4Y power supply with every 3-4 modulators when ordered in lieu of PS12-2
